## Runbook: Bulk Edits in the Ferrock Admin Table

Quick one for release night: bulk edits go through the `batch-apply` worker, not the UI thread, so if rows look stuck, it's the worker. Check BULK_BATCH_SIZE (keep it at 200 — bigger batches lock the table) and BULK_RETRY_COUNT before panicking. Rollbacks are automatic if more than 5% of rows fail. The worker needs to auth against the admin API to do any of this, and that credential sits on the very next line.

sealed setting: LEDGER_TOKEN13=5d842615a26d7

Ticket: Vault won't open — Reportly sort-stability fix blocked

Hi plugin authors — we shipped the stable-sort patch for the report builder (ties now keep insertion order, finally), but the signing vault locked itself before we could sign the SDK build, so your plugin updates are stuck in review. We'll unseal today and re-sign. If you run a private signing mirror, unseal it the same way with the passphrase below.

recovery phrase for bawef-kagug: casix-tamvan-lamath-holeth-gilmir-drudor-julax-wenok-wenael-rusvan-holax-goriel-frawyn

## Fare Split Experiment — Support Notes

The Quillgate ticketing team is running a pricing experiment on the Larkspur venue tier through the end of the quarter. Roughly half of buyers see dynamic pricing; the rest see flat rates. If a customer reports a price mismatch, do not issue a refund immediately — first confirm which cohort they belong to using the order's experiment tag. Full cohort definitions, refund rules, and escalation steps are documented on the internal experiment page.

operations page: https://confluence.tolvaqsys.corp/spaces/pages/pages/6e787158f507

Quarterly Planning Note — Lease Renegotiation

For the board. Ostrand Logistics is renegotiating the Welbeck depot lease ahead of renewal. Targets: 12% rent reduction, five-year term, expanded dock access. Landlord countered at 7%; gap closing. Fallback site identified if talks stall. Decision expected within three weeks; no operational disruption anticipated. Rationale is stated below.

board note of bajop-yaweg: The western region missed its Pelys quota by 58.0 percent last quarter. Pelysek Foods plans to raise the Belius list price by 44.0 percent in July. The steering committee signed off on a budget of $133.8 million for Project Pelax. The renewal with Zoraelix Systems closes at $61.9 million a year, 12.7 percent above the last contract.